Я нахожу, что журналы syslogd "Cosole" моего Mac становятся непригодными, когда какое-то плохо написанное приложение (в данном случае PathFinder.app ) непрерывно вливается в syslogd весь день .. Я где-то читал, что вы можете отключить ведение журнала в приложении по ..
Создание псевдонима для исполняемого пакета внутри "пакета" приложения, а затем ТОЛЬКО запуск этого псевдонима из терминала. Процесс был ... Перейдите к /Applications/ObnoxiousLogger.app, щелкните правой кнопкой мыши, "Показать содержимое пакета", а затем перейдите к ...
/Applications/ObnoxiousLogger.app/Contents/MacOS/ObnoxiousLogger
Затем вы создаете псевдоним через графический интерфейс и не забываете всегда запускать приложение из этого псевдонима, снова ТОЛЬКО через терминал.
Это раздражает, так как вы ДОЛЖНЫ создавать псевдоним через Finder (символическая ссылка не работает, и нет способа создать псевдоним через терминал). И если он запускается любым другим способом, вы вернетесь к исходной точке , логорея.. Этот метод работал, но в течение очень короткого периода времени.
Казалось бы, вы можете установить это с помощью команды launchctl или переменной plist , но это не приложение, которое запускает launchd, и документация launchd так повсеместно, но я думаю, что это возможно, я предположим.
Я видел кое-что об отправке журнала в /dev /null, но не было ясно, был ли это какой-то канал syslogd, или команда, или параметр /etc/syslogd.conf, или что ...
Пожалуйста, дайте мне знать, если у вас есть надежный способ выборочно отключить ведение журнала для каждого приложения или, что еще лучше, увеличить или уменьшить подробность ведения журнала, для процесса / команды и т.д. В Mac OS X.